Key Insights
The stealth technology market is experiencing robust growth, projected to maintain a Compound Annual Growth Rate (CAGR) exceeding 6% from 2025 to 2033. This expansion is driven by escalating geopolitical tensions, the increasing demand for advanced military capabilities, and ongoing technological advancements in radar-evading materials and designs. Key players like Raytheon Technologies, Thales, Lockheed Martin, and Boeing are heavily investing in research and development, fueling innovation and competition within the sector. The market segmentation reveals a significant demand across aerial, marine, and terrestrial platforms, with aerial platforms currently holding the largest share due to the high strategic importance of stealth aircraft in modern warfare. However, growth in marine and terrestrial stealth technologies is expected to accelerate as countries prioritize defense modernization and asymmetrical warfare strategies. While technological challenges and high development costs present some restraints, the substantial government funding allocated to defense budgets globally continues to propel the market forward. The Asia-Pacific region, particularly China, is anticipated to witness substantial growth driven by increased military spending and indigenous technological development.
The North American market currently dominates the stealth technology landscape, driven by the strong presence of major defense contractors and substantial defense budgets. However, the European and Asia-Pacific regions are rapidly gaining ground. The ongoing competition among major players fosters innovation, pushing the boundaries of stealth technology. Stealth Technology Industry Product Landscape
Stealth technology encompasses various products, including radar-absorbing materials (RAM), low-observable airframes, advanced sensor systems, and electronic warfare countermeasures. Product innovations focus on improving radar cross-section (RCS) reduction, enhancing survivability, and integrating advanced sensors for improved situational awareness. Unique selling propositions revolve around improved performance metrics such as reduced detectability, enhanced maneuverability, and improved survivability in hostile environments.

8. Can you provide examples of recent developments in the market?
In November 2021, the United Kingdom announced that four Dreadnought Class submarines are being built to replace the current fleet of Vanguard Class boats. The submarines will be armed with Trident D5 missiles and incorporate a number of new stealth features.
